Output 757499891d84ece41db8f45f2406b8d9a27177bda6379f8f7afb9b71e4cea25d:0

value
27570
script pubkey
OP_0 OP_PUSHBYTES_20 15d2cd701458584cacaf39cb51d65384143c0225
address
bc1qzhfv6uq5tpvyet908894r4jnss2rcq39mr4drl
transaction
757499891d84ece41db8f45f2406b8d9a27177bda6379f8f7afb9b71e4cea25d
confirmations
142009
spent
true